Goldfield Insurance Brokers Limited v Public Procurement Administrative Review Board & 2 others; Utmost Insurance Brokers Limited (Interested Party) (Judicial Review Application E002 of 2026) [2026] KEHC 19 (KLR) (Judicial Review) (6 January 2026) (Ruling)

Goldfield Insurance Brokers Limited v Public Procurement Administrative Review Board & 2 others; Utmost Insurance Brokers Limited (Interested Party) (Judicial Review Application E002 of 2026) [2026] KEHC 19 (KLR) (Judicial Review) (6 January 2026) (Ruling)

The applicant has demonstrated an arguable case that warrants consideration on its merits at the substantive stage, thus leave to apply for judicial review is granted.
